Subject: [Bluez-users] hidd connect permissions

# hidd -n --server
hidd[32412]: Bluetooth HID daemon
hidd[32412]: Rejected connection from unknown device 00:12:EE:07:95:48
(same result running as non-root user)

Remote device is a Sony Ericsson K750i, using inbuilt HID controller. Phone
is paired with the computer, file transfer (using kdebluetooth or obexftp)
and rfcomm devices both work.

This used to work with bluez-2.25, current (non-working) version is 3.7.
Installed from ebuilds out of liquidx's overlay, on gentoo/amd64 2006.1
(http://overlays.gentoo.org/dev/liquidx/browser/net-wireless).

Does hidd have a configuration file that isn't documented anywhere?

Subject: Re: [Bluez-users] hidd connect permissions

Thanks for that. Removed my phone from the linkkeys file, connected
with 'hidd --connect 00:12:EE:07:95:48', re-paired and all was well.
Discovered my phone even asks if you want to open the remote control app when
hidd requests it.

Subject: Re: [Bluez-users] hidd connect permissions

Hi Thomas,

> # hidd -n --server
> hidd[32412]: Bluetooth HID daemon
> hidd[32412]: Rejected connection from unknown device 00:12:EE:07:95:48
> (same result running as non-root user)

connect from the Linux machine once again. It needs to store the HID
descriptor and authorize the phone first.
